Rotor blades are vital parts for any helicopter as they can significantly impact crucial flight parameters like cruise speed, climb rate, and payload capacity. Well-designed, high-performance rotor blades can offer improved controllability, especially during operations like rescue missions, air medical services, executive endeavors and more.

Based on material, carbon fiber reinforced plastic (CFRP) segment is estimated to account for a considerable share in helicopter blades market in the future. Demands for CFRP can be attributed to its key characteristics like lower weight, higher stiffness, and superior strength to weight ratio. Manufacturers are also increasingly developing carbon-fiber blades to minimize production cost and improve operational margins.

For instance, in 2018, rotor-blade maker Van Horn Aviation exhibited its FAA-certified composite main and tail rotor blades, made from carbon-fiber skins & spars, foam cores, and replaceable abrasion strips for the Bell 206L Long Ranger helicopter, claiming service life of the composite blades to be two to four times more than their metal counterparts.
